Melting points of compounds of the heavier Group 14 elements: the influence of the polarizability effect

The literature data on melting points (Tm) of silicon, germanium, tin, and lead compounds of 26 narrow series has been analyzed. The considered compounds form weak intermolecular complexes, which leads to the appearance of the polarizability effect. Using the correlation analysis, it was established for the first time that the Tm values depend on the combined influence of the inductive, resonance, polarizability, and steric effects of substituents. The contribution of the polarizability effect reaches 65%.
